FAA remarks for KWMC

  • CONSTRUCTED PRIOR TO 5/15/59.
  • ACTVT REIL RWYS 14 & 32, 20; MIRL RWY 14/32 - CTAF. PRESET LO INTST; INCR/DECR INTST - CTAF.
  • AFT HRS OR EMERG CALL (775) 304-5885.
  • FBO - WINNEMUCCA AIR SERVICE 775-623-5091.
  • PCR VALUE: 80/F/C/X/T
  • PCR VALUE: 340/F/C/X/T
  • UNMRKD 25 FT X 25 FT CONCRETE TLOF ADJACENT TO APRON PRKG AND TWY ALPHA.
  • H2 ADJACENT TO APRON PRKG AND TAXIWAY ALPHA
  • H1 PAD PERIMETER EDGING IS DAMAGED
  • H2 PERIMETER EDGING IS DAMAGED.
  • FULL STRENGTH PAVEMENT AREAS INCLUDE N 1000 FT OF PARALLEL TWY (RWY 14/32 TO TWY A); W 1000 FT OF TWY A; 600 FT OF N/S TWR (FM TWY A).
  • MOUNTAINS IN SW QUADRANT.
  • CALL FBO FOR CURRENT RWY CONDS IN WINTER MONTHS.
  • FOR CD IF UNA TO CTC ON FSS FREQ, CTC SALT LAKE ARTCC AT 801-320-2568.

Selective GPS coverage

Winnemucca Municipal’s instrument arrival set is concentrated on two runway ends: both published approaches are RNAV (GPS), while the other two fixed-wing ends have no approach in this cycle. This provides GPS-based arrival coverage in two directions rather than across every runway alignment. Two obstacle departure procedures provide corresponding departure guidance, while the airport diagram records the ground layout.

Runway and VFR context

The 7,000 ft runway is 2,200 ft longer than the second fixed-wing runway, creating a substantial difference in runway length between alignments. The Klamath Falls and Salt Lake City sectionals add broader VFR planning context beyond the terminal procedures.
